MPEG streamclip would USUALLY be the answer. Problem with that, is the audio conversion. If the audio is already captured at 24bit/48k, & you select no transcode on options there, you Might be ok. As we have found out, THAT isn't always the case. Your ONLY sure fire bet is to transcode thru "compressor". Yes, you have to tie up an edit machine. (Sort of)-- You COULD use any Mac with "compressor" installed. A good sure solution is to build a preset in "compressor", make it a "droplet" & drop that file onto there. ---Some caveat---, compressor settings work with Blackstorm. MPEG streamclip settings do NOT always interpret the video settings (ie. 960 pixels..,, etc((too much to list))
Your best bet, (that I Know of, right now), Is, to creat that setting in "compressor" & 'automate' the conversion process with apple's 'Automator' App. In doing so, you can make the conversion process a 'ONE TOUCH' process.
